from m5.params import *
from m5.objects.Workload import SEWorkload
class MipsSEWorkload(SEWorkload):
type = 'MipsSEWorkload'
cxx_header = "arch/mips/se_workload.hh"
cxx_class = 'MipsISA::SEWorkload'
abstract = True
class MipsEmuLinux(MipsSEWorkload):
type = 'MipsEmuLinux'
cxx_header = "arch/mips/linux/se_workload.hh"
cxx_class = 'MipsISA::EmuLinux'
@classmethod
def _is_compatible_with(cls, obj):
return obj.get_arch() == 'mips' and \
obj.get_op_sys() in ('linux', 'unknown')
